Norden Group LLC reduced its stock position in Citigroup Inc. (NYSE:C)

Norden Group LLC reduced its stake in Citigroup Inc. (NYSE:C – Free Report) by 4.7% in the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 17,438 shares of the company’s stock after selling 866 shares during the period. Norden Group LLC’s holdings in Citigroup were worth $1,107,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Citigroup (NYSE:C – Get Free Report ) last released its earnings results on Friday, July 12th. The company reported $1.52 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.39 by $0.13. Citigroup had a net margin of 4.95% and a return on equity of 6.26%. The company had revenue of $20.14 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$20.07 billion. In the same quarter last year, the company posted earnings of $1.37 per share.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 3.6% year over year. As a group, analysts predict that Citigroup Inc. will post 5.82 EPS for the current year.

Citigroup raises dividend

The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, August 23rd. Investors of record on Monday, August 5th were given a dividend of $0.56 per share. This represents a dividend of $2.24 on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.79%. The ex-dividend date was Monday, August 5. This is a boost from Citigroup’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.53. Citigroup’s dividend payout ratio is 62.75%.

Citigroup Company Profile

(Free report)

Citigroup Inc, a diversified financial services holding company, provides various financial products and services to consumers, corporations, governments and institutions around the world. It operates through five segments: Services, Markets, Banking, US Personal Banking and Wealth. The Services segment includes Treasury and Trade Solutions, which provides cash management, trade and working capital solutions to multinational corporations, financial institutions and public sector organizations; and Securities Services, such as cross-border client support, local market expertise, post-trade technologies, data solutions and various securities service solutions.
